Output e8faeb023dce91b8a826aede690225c95a7c2017ca83031b40812964681fddc0:0

value
79260
script pubkey
OP_0 OP_PUSHBYTES_20 3611c96e7ce7b2ade289aa7efed79725637bf1c6
address
bc1qxcgujmnuu7e2mc5f4fl0a4uhy43hhuwx7tusx9
transaction
e8faeb023dce91b8a826aede690225c95a7c2017ca83031b40812964681fddc0
confirmations
16362
spent
true